Although this this same principle applies to many fuel tanks, check to see if the manufacturer of the tank has a sticker with pressure testing specs. Boat tanks are usually rated for a max testing pressure of 3lbs on most tanks. You don't want to rupture your tank.

Joe, excellent video. Do you know the purpose of the 3rd point off to the side?
@vicpetrishak7705
@vicpetrishak7705 Жыл бұрын
When adjusting the spark length to indicate the coil power condition if moved too far the spark will jump to the third point . On two point testers it may seek ground back into the module possibly shorting the module out . 1/23
